Synopsis:
Bubisher, besides meaning “a bird that brings luck”, is the name of a lorry loaded with Spanish literature that serves the Sahrawi refugee camps of Tindouf. The communication of two cultures through short stories and tales might seem paradoxical, but so is the contrast between the efforts of a young generation of women to overcome the odds and the reality of life in the desert.
